You'll also be responsible to pay for any prescriptions prescribed by your psychiatrist. These prescriptions are not covered by the NHS therefore you will need to pay for them directly. In some cases, you may need to attend follow-up appointments to check your medication. These follow-up appointments are typically every 3-4 weeks until you're stable on the dosage.
Ask your GP whether they'll sign a shared-care agreement with your private Psychiatrist. This will stop you from being diagnosed privately and then having to go to the NHS where your doctor may not be able to approve of your treatment plan. Some doctors will not sign this agreement, which could be frustrating.
The process of determining ADHD as an adult requires a thorough background check and interview with a trained healthcare professional. This is a complicated and challenging process, which is why it can't be rushed. NICE guidelines say that psychiatrists licensed in the UK or a specialist ADHD Nurse can only conduct a psychiatric evaluation for ADHD.
There is a shortage of ADHD assessors in the NHS, which can lead to long waiting times. If you are registered with a GP, you can choose your own ADHD Assessor. This is known as the "Right to choose" option. Independent providers usually have a shorter waiting time than the NHS. Additionally, some of them provide appointments online via video calls. This makes it much easier to obtain an ADHD evaluation for those with a restricted mobility.

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der that is defined in the DSM5 manual for mental health diagnosis. It's a behavioural condition that is characterised by inattentiveness and hyperactivity/impulsivity. These symptoms cannot be typical for your age group and must occur in a variety of situations (e.g. at home and school). They should also last for more than 6 months and interfere with your social, academic and professional performance.
If you're a student, you could be evaluated for ADHD by an educational psychologist. Their report can be used to justify your claim for reasonable accommodations and a Disabled Student's Allowance. This is especially useful for students who have ADHD and require additional support at the university.

If you have ADHD as an adult, it is crucial to obtain a full diagnosis and discuss the treatment options. This evaluation should be conducted by a psychiatrist or a specialist mental health nurse because they are the sole healthcare professionals qualified to diagnose ADHD in the UK. The test typically involves a 45 to 90-minute discussion with the psychiatrist and should cover your overall mental health, family history and other factors that could influence ADHD symptoms.
In addition to assessing your symptoms the psychiatrist is likely to want to rule out other illnesses that may be misinterpreted as ADHD, such as thyroid, anxiety, depression or issues. They will also look over your family background and school records. The process could take a while, but it is worth the wait.
If you have a doctor in England you can make use of your Right to Choose to select the psychiatrist who will evaluate your condition for ADHD. You can also ask your GP to refer you to a private provider who offers shared care agreements with the NHS for ADHD medication, meaning that you will only pay the NHS prescription fee. These providers have shorter waiting times than the NHS and many offer appointments via video chat.
